Sensor networks contain of a large number of embedded computers called devices. The devices are equipped with short-range low-power radios for communications. Sensor networks present the challenge of building large-scale distributed systems that are tightly coupled with the physical world in an extremely resource constrained environment and need to function for a long time providing a desirable level of performance. The ZigBee standard is a standard that supports wireless networked embedded systems that have come into importance over the past five years.
